Danny Flores

January 27, 1967 — December 26, 2020

            Funeral service for Danny Flores, Jr., age 53, of Frederick, Oklahoma, will be held at 11:00 a.m. Thursday, December 31, 2020, at the Restoration Church (1920 N. 15th Street), with Pastor James Johnson, Marcus Booker and Johnny Flores officiating. *Due to COVID, masks will be mandatory.

            Danny passed away Saturday, December 26, 2020, at a Lawton, Oklahoma, hospital.

            Burial will be in the Frederick Memorial Cemetery under the direction of Orr Gray Gish Funeral Home.

            He was born January 27, 1967, in Clinton, Oklahoma, to Danny and Mary (Garza) Flores. He grew up and attended Frederick schools and graduated from Frederick High School with the Class of 1986. Danny loved and participated in sports throughout his school years. That love continued as he spent countless dedicated hours volunteering for the Frederick Quarterback Club. He not only loved the young men and women he impacted, but he loved the fellowship and enriched relationships he had with those he served within the organization.  Needless to say, Wednesday nights painting the Bomber Bowl field won’t be the same without Danny. Whether it was painting the field, a hotdog/hamburger feed, fundraising, or any type of endeavor for the Quarterback Club, he was front and center and always willing to help in any way possible, and with a cheerful heart. In 2000, Danny began working at what is now Henniges Automotive Manufacturer, where he was employed as a Team Molder at the time of his death. When he started his job he also started a friendship with Sherri Barnard, who began work there at the same time, and their friendship became a long lasting love affair. Danny was not only a fanatic supporter of Frederick Bomber Football and other athletics but was an avid fan of the San Francisco 49ers NFL football team. He was a member of the Restoration Church of Frederick.

            He was preceded in death by his grandparents: Adela and Raymond Garza, and Josephine and Frank Flores, Sr.; and a sister: Kristine Flores.

            Survivors include Sherri Barnard, of the home in Frederick; children: Brittany (Flores) Jackson, Cody Duncan, Deseree Luna, Destiny Barnard, and Madison Barnard; parents: Danny and Mary Flores; sister: Angie (Flores Cotten); brother: Johnny Flores and wife Lori; grandchildren: Steven, Anthony, Whittany, Noah, Jerry, and Sebastian Jackson, Nah-Miah Finley, and Isaiah Goodday; numerous nieces nephews, a host of extended family and friends.
